How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 48104?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 48104 Studio Apartments | $2,326 | $921 | $17,000 |
| 48104 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,117 | $850 | $95,000 |
| 48104 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,227 | $850 | $5,020 |
| 48104 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,574 | $1,399 | $4,575 |
| 48104 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,517 | $690 | $6,040 |
| 48104 5 Bedroom Apartments | $3,398 | $1,299 | $8,000 |
| 48104 6 Bedroom Apartments | $5,688 | $849 | $8,690 |
